McAllen Medical Center ATM
(800) 513-7678
301 West Expressway 83, Mcallen, Texas, 78503
Business hours
ATM availability based on building access
About us
ATM availability based on building access
Click to learn more about Frost!
| Services | Lobby ATM |
Featured businesses
901 Trenton Rd, , Mcallen, Texas, 78504
(956) 305-1698
630 S 23rd St, , Mcallen, Texas, 78501
(956) 996-6814
2200 S 10th St, , Mcallen, Texas, 78503
(956) 253-0945
100 N 10th St, , Mcallen, Texas, 78501
(855) 264-2046
3500 Pecan Blvd, , Mcallen, Texas, 78501
(956) 253-1911